Alfred Mason (1837-1895) was an Anglican priest in Australia.[1]

Mason was educated at St Augustine's College, Canterbury. He served incumbencies at New Town, Tasmania and Evandale, Tasmania.[2] He was Archdeacon of Hobart from 1888 until his death.[3]
